WebJan 31, 2012 · 1 Toxic Effects and Mode of Action. Citric acid is absorbed from the gastrointestinal tract. Metabolism of the substance involves the citric acid cycle, the synthesis of fats and amino acids, and gluconeogenesis. WebApr 1, 2024 · Under these conditions, 0.25 % citric acid found to have similar efficacy. These findings indicate that 0.5 % citric acid or 1 % sodium hypochlorite are likely to be effective disinfectants for M. bovis under field conditions and 0.04 % sodium hypochlorite or 0.25 % citric acid are likely to be effective following removal of organic material.
